                    Here's a stupid question:  Is the Christy sole the Vibram 1010 Armortread or is it a different sole model?  4014?  What there a difference between the 1010 and the 4014?

                    For the record, I like the Gloxi-Cut sole…

                    ATX IH Hoarder

                    last edited by 1 Reply Last reply Reply Quote 0
                    • AppfaffA
                      Appfaff
                      Raw and Unwashed
                      Joined:

                      ^yeah Gloxi-Cut for life.

                      FWIW the 4041 is the traditional “Christy” but I think people lump all foam based soles into the Christy category.

                      I have the 2021 on two pairs of boots and prefer it in almost all ways…

                          Ok, so my IH 62 indigo wabash needs a wash.. are there any precautions I need to take? Concerns about streaks? Should I presoak and use a front loading machine? Spin no spin? Dryer or hang to dry?

                          Maybe so. Maybe not

                          last edited by 1 Reply Last reply Reply Quote 0
                          • AlexA
                            Alex
                            IHUK Crew
                            Joined:

                            40 Deg Celcius max, no - low spin, drip dry

                            last edited by 1 Reply Last reply Reply Quote 0
                            • S
                              sabergirl
                              見習いボス
                              Joined:

                              I always just turn it inside-out, and chuck it in the top-loader we have at home, warm water, regular cycle with spin. Then I tumble dry it, hot.  Of course, I wasn't at all worried about shrinkage, and I did get some the first couple times.  No weird streaks or anything, though.

                                        Alex, if I’m looking for a little shrink can I increase the temp of the water? Or do u advise against that?

                                        Maybe so. Maybe not

                                        last edited by 1 Reply Last reply Reply Quote 0
                                        • neph93N
                                          neph93
                                          見習いボス
                                          Joined:

                                          I’ve blasted some of my wabash on 90C with 800rpm to get max shrinkage. It doesn’t shrink quite as much as UHR for example but it’s quite effective.

                                          I’d say wash at 40C and see how you feel. If there isn’t enough action go to 60. One thing, washing will accelerate wear on exposed areas (collar, cuffs, hems, hemmed corners etc.).

                                            For sure, you are not more at risk of streaks from hotter water, but of shrinkage. If you wash at 40 and need more shrink, try at 50, then 60etc.
